Police are appealing for information after an 18-year-old woman failed to return from a hike in Nattai National Park in the NSW Southern Highlands area.
Lily Hooper was last seen in at about 8am in Oakdale on Wednesday, August 12, with the intention of going for a hike.
When she could not be contacted, officers attached to The Hume Police District were notified and commenced inquiries into her whereabouts.

Police and family hold serious concerns for her welfare.
Lily is described as being of Caucasian appearance, about 175cm tall, of slim build, and long blonde hair and blue eyes.
She was last seen wearing a shirt and shorts.
Police have since located her vehicle near the Bonnum Pic Walking Trail along Wanganderry Road.
A multiagency search continued on Friday morning, with the Lifesaver 21 crew spending all of Wednesday searching various areas, supporting Rescue and Bomb Disposal, NSW Police and the SES.
Anyone with information on Lily’s whereabouts, or walked the Bonnum Pic Walking Trail yesterday, is urged to contact Moss Vale Police Station or Crime Stoppers.
